About Ambrose
Ambrose is a small rural locality in the Gladstone Region of Central Queensland, situated approximately 30 kilometres north-west of Gladstone between the major coastal city and the regional centre of Rockhampton. The locality covers around 63 square kilometres and has a population of 217 residents. Ambrose is a typical Central Queensland rural community, with the flat to gently undulating terrain supporting grazing and agricultural operations characteristic of the broader Gladstone hinterland.
Residents rely on the city of Gladstone for schools, shopping, healthcare, and employment, with the short drive making it a manageable commute for those working in Gladstone's significant industrial port and resource sector. The Gladstone Region is one of Queensland's most economically active, home to a major port, aluminium smelter, and LNG facilities, providing employment opportunities that underpin the broader regional community. Ambrose itself retains a quiet, rural character with farming the mainstay of local land use.
